  1. // SPDX-License-Identifier: GPL-2.0
  2. /*
  3. * Generic sigma delta modulator driver
  4. *
  5. * Copyright (C) 2017, STMicroelectronics - All Rights Reserved
  6. * Author: Arnaud Pouliquen <arnaud.pouliquen@st.com>.
  7. */
  8. #include <linux/iio/iio.h>
  9. #include <linux/iio/triggered_buffer.h>
  10. #include <linux/module.h>
  11. #include <linux/mod_devicetable.h>
  12. #include <linux/platform_device.h>
  13. static const struct iio_info iio_sd_mod_iio_info;
  14. static const struct iio_chan_spec iio_sd_mod_ch = {
  15. .type = IIO_VOLTAGE,
  16. .indexed = 1,
  17. .scan_type = {
  18. .sign = 'u',
  19. .realbits = 1,
  20. .shift = 0,
  21. },
  22. };
  23. static int iio_sd_mod_probe(struct platform_device *pdev)
  24. {
  25. struct device *dev = &pdev->dev;
  26. struct iio_dev *iio;
  27. iio = devm_iio_device_alloc(dev, 0);
  28. if (!iio)
  29. return -ENOMEM;
  30. iio->name = dev_name(dev);
  31. iio->info = &iio_sd_mod_iio_info;
  32. iio->modes = INDIO_BUFFER_HARDWARE;
  33. iio->num_channels = 1;
  34. iio->channels = &iio_sd_mod_ch;
  35. platform_set_drvdata(pdev, iio);
  36. return devm_iio_device_register(&pdev->dev, iio);
  37. }
  38. static const struct of_device_id sd_adc_of_match[] = {
  39. { .compatible = "sd-modulator" },
  40. { .compatible = "ads1201" },
  41. { }
  42. };
  43. MODULE_DEVICE_TABLE(of, sd_adc_of_match);
  44. static struct platform_driver iio_sd_mod_adc = {
  45. .driver = {
  46. .name = "iio_sd_adc_mod",
  47. .of_match_table = sd_adc_of_match,
  48. },
  49. .probe = iio_sd_mod_probe,
  50. };
  51. module_platform_driver(iio_sd_mod_adc);
  52. MODULE_DESCRIPTION("Basic sigma delta modulator");
  53. MODULE_AUTHOR("Arnaud Pouliquen <arnaud.pouliquen@st.com>");
  54. MODULE_LICENSE("GPL v2");
